No real change from John Moss's last weeks visit which is no surprise being that, it not only was a full moon but a super full one. However yesterday and today have been quite warm with a breeze as well. As explained there was no inspection this weekend conducted due to the SA general meeting in Tailem Bend. Last inspection saw a dry surface other than 10mm of surface water from the shore out to about 100 metres. The rest of the surface looks really good and a good covering of salt has been built up.
